Overall Meaning

In Bandido's song "Arcie," the lyrics tell the story of two people, one from Spain and the other from Sta. Mesa, who have feelings for each other despite their different backgrounds and financial situations. The singer of the song, who is from Sta. Mesa, notices that even though they are not that far apart geographically, there is still a great distance between them because of their differing circumstances. He admires Arcie's complexion and hopes that love can transcend these differences. However, the singer struggles with finances, barely having enough money for food each day, while Arcie has a budget of one hundred and fifty pesos for each meal. The singer hopes to build a restaurant or food establishment to assure Arcie that she never has to experience hunger again. In the end, he has to accept a sad reality that Arcie has moved on and chose someone else over him.


The song addresses themes of class and the struggle of ordinary people in society along with the power of love that is suppressed by these circumstances. The lyrics highlight the realities of having a relationship with someone from a different social status, especially in the Philippines where the class division is prevalent. The singer is willing to do everything he can to make things work between them, even if it means taking a backseat or giving up something. Despite the outcome, the song evokes feelings of hope and sacrifice, and it is a story of what could have been, and what is.
